I know there has been a lot of talk about gap issues as I know the lofts are strong and I'm ok with that, I had to let my SM9 wedges go as my gapping was too far off and decided on getting 2 RTX6 wedges a 48* and 54* with Steelfiber shafts as so now between my PW an Approach wedge is about 6* and another 6* between my next Sand wedge. I also wanted to have the same shafts in my irons as what will be in my wedges. I played last years RTX wedges and thought I made a mistake when I sold them.  My 5 thru PW are so very consistent in ball flight and yardages as I feel that my 5 irons is just as easy to hit as my 9 iron. Very impressed

On 4/22/2023 at 10:37 AM, this_is_golf said:

Has anyone bent the HMP 1 or 2 degrees weak? I’m looking to increase launch and peak height a bit. Any feedback is appreciated. 

I got my HMP's 2* weak from the factory. I needed some more spin since I fit into C-Tapers really well and it's been great. I was a little worried about the extra bounce it added, but I haven't actually noticed it at all.

I’m still toying with the HMP vs my 923 Tours. I’m leaning more towards the Tours right now for the feel and accuracy. 
 

The HMPs feel great for a cast club, but in comparison to the Tour it’s not close.

 

The main issue is with the distance consistency. I do get more jumpers from the HMP than I am happy with.

 

I’ve been playing well with the HMPs, but the Tours are going back in the bag for a few rounds. It will be interesting to see if the forgiveness of the HMP vs the accuracy of the Tours plays out.

32 minutes ago, PrettyGood said:

For those who ordered their HMPs a degree or two weak — was there any noticeable change in the appearance of the irons at address?

After a month or so of playing standard lofts I had my 923 HMP  7-PW bent to the 923 Forged lofts.  The PW and 9 iron look great with the reduced offset.  Don't really notice any difference on 8 and 7 irons.  Regardless it definitely helps tame some of the crazy distances I was seeing and has added some spin and stopping power on the greens.
